"Gaming Upgrade Surprise: What Really Boosted My Performance Beyond Just FPS"

As I upgraded my gaming rig, I expected a boost in frames per second (FPS) to be the primary benefit. However, what I discovered was that the real game-changer lay elsewhere. The upgrade, which included a new graphics card and RAM, did improve my FPS, but it was the reduction in latency and improvement in overall system responsiveness that had the most significant impact on my gaming experience.

The key development behind this unexpected improvement was the implementation of advanced technologies such as NVIDIA's DLSS (Deep Learning Super Sampling) and AMD's Smart Access Memory (SAM). These innovations have enabled graphics cards to render images more efficiently, reducing the time it takes for the system to process and display graphics. As a result, my gaming experience became smoother and more immersive, with fewer stutters and frame drops. Moreover, the upgrade also brought about a noticeable decrease in loading times, allowing me to dive into my favorite games more quickly.
